Output 98d0b53f08a9333b358a2c57e443af10ac3b51d99ae69d14bccf1297a3f0a071:1

value
34369100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 055b98206db69a0bbbbe850806438818d94b16ea OP_EQUAL
address
32BM2ak93yPKzpdrcsinEtopKoxC5oYxtU
transaction
98d0b53f08a9333b358a2c57e443af10ac3b51d99ae69d14bccf1297a3f0a071
confirmations
363038
spent
true